[cfinformatica-grup] Re: MarkDown per fitxers publicables/executables

  • From: Joan Josep Ordinas Rosa <jordinas@xxxxxxxxxxxxxxxxxxxxxxxxxxx>
  • To: cfinformatica-grup@xxxxxxxxxxxxx
  • Date: Mon, 22 Feb 2016 19:13:15 +0100

2016-02-21 11:02 GMT+01:00 q2dg2b . <q2dg2b@xxxxxxxxx>:

Molt interessant, gràcies!

Un petit detall...a la secció de "How to publish the examples?" fas servir
la comanda yum...Potser caldria especificar que aquesta comanda només és per
sistemes Fedora o, en tot cas, ni això perquè des de fa unes versions
s'utilitza la comanda dnf. I potser aportar algun exemple més de com es
diuen els paquets a instal.lar en altres distribucions. Sé que és una
xorrada, però en fi, per si de cas.

SI algú instal·la pandoc i texlive en un sistema amb apt-get, i em diu
l'ordre exacte, la puc afegir a la documentació.

Pel que fa a sistemes amb`dnf` no cal patir. També tenen yum:

$ file $(which yum)
/usr/bin/yum: Bourne-Again shell script, ASCII text executable

$ cat $(which yum)
#!/bin/bash
# The yum executable redirecting to dnf from dnf-yum compatible package.
# This is shell script and not python script to avoid python2/3 conflicts.
#
...
#

executable="/usr/bin/dnf"
msg="Yum command has been deprecated, redirecting to '$executable $@'.\n"\
"See 'man dnf' and 'man yum2dnf' for more information.\n"\
"To transfer transaction metadata from yum to DNF, run:\n"\
"'dnf install python-dnf-plugins-extras-migrate && dnf-2 migrate'\n"

echo -e $msg >&2
exec $executable "$@"

Other related posts: